From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Crosshead \Cross"head`\ (-h?d), n. (Mach.)
     A beam or bar across the head or end of a rod, etc., or a
     block attached to it and carrying a knuckle pin; as the solid
     crosspiece running between parallel slides, which receives
     motion from the piston of a steam engine and imparts it to
     the connecting rod, which is hinged to the crosshead.


     [1913 Webster]

From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:

  crosshead
       n 1: a heading of a subsection printed within the body of the
            text [syn: {crossheading}]
       2: metal block that connects to a piston; it slides on parallel
          guides and moves a connecting rod back and forth
